Pharmacovigilance and Risk Management Strategies Conference

Session 9: Considerations for Medication Error Pharmacovigilance

Medication errors have a significant public health burden. This session will discuss the impact of medication errors, current state of medication error pharmacovigilance, and propose directions for building a pharmacovigilance medication error program for the future.

Learning Objective :

At the conclusion of this session, participants should be able to:

  • Recognize that medication error prevention requires a collaborative effort among regulators, industry, patients, healthcare providers, and other stakeholders
  • Identify differences and challenges in the approach for medication error pharmacovigilance versus adverse event pharmacovigilance
  • Describe current and emerging approaches for surveilling medication errors
